Output 94e59ca72630a1130318c388952f2ea2cc378d91cc0c45870a7e2e864191342a:1

value
29581763
script pubkey
OP_0 OP_PUSHBYTES_20 303f927b3259b77cf04e0d6581c69bd2dc1809c6
address
bc1qxqley7ejtxmheuzwp4jcr35m6twpszwxdxuuan
transaction
94e59ca72630a1130318c388952f2ea2cc378d91cc0c45870a7e2e864191342a
spent
true